Can A Licensed Practical Nurse Afford Rent in Phenix City, AL?

Stretched but workable — rent takes 32% of gross income.

Phenix City rent: July 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Alabama state estimate).

Phenix City median rent
$1,392/mo
Licensed Practical Nurse salary (Alabama)
$52,279/yr
Rent as % of income
32%
Gross monthly income works out to about $4,357,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,307/mo in rent. Phenix City's median rent of $1,392 exceeds that threshold by $85/mo, putting a licensed practical nurse salary into the rent-burdened range here. A licensed practical nurse works roughly 55.4 hours a month to cover that r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Alabama state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Phenix City, AL.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
